New Delhi, September 12 (Daily Kiran) : The 18th BRICS Summit is currently underway at Bharat Mandapam in New Delhi, where journalists from around the world are discussing India’s pivotal role and the significance of the conference. Many have highlighted India’s commitment to amplifying the voice of the Global South on the global stage.

Siabonga Goodman, a journalist from South Africa’s National Media Group, remarked on the BRICS Summit, stating, “I want to begin by recalling that during India’s G20 presidency in 2023, it was Prime Minister Modi who pushed for the African Union to be granted permanent membership. From this perspective, as a South African and an African, I believe India has genuinely led efforts to ensure that the Global South community becomes a key partner in multilateral discussions. Now, as we talk about BRICS, we are moving beyond a unipolar world. Many of us view BRICS as an essential institution.”

Odoh Innocent, head of the diplomatic desk at Nigeria’s Leadership Newspaper, commented on the bilateral trade between Nigeria and India. He noted, “Trade between Nigeria and India has been significant. A few years ago, our trade volume was around $27 billion, which has now decreased to approximately $14.9 billion. However, with strengthened ties, we aim to restore our trade to the original $27 billion and beyond. This BRICS Summit has indeed opened more opportunities for us to engage with India and other BRICS members across various economic sectors.”
